The governor of Rivers, Nyesom Wike, has issued a query to the vice chancellor of the state university, Professor Blessing Didia, over reports of shooting within the institution’s campus.

A short statement from Simeon Nwakaudu, Wike’s media aide, said the query also had to do with recent rampant complaints of bribery, informally known as ‘sorting’, within the university system. “Governor Wike directed the vice chancellor of the Rivers state university to respond to the query in writing within 24 hours,” the statement said.

it was earlier reported that Governor Wike recently approved the appointment of the emir of Lafia, HRH Sidi M Bage, as the chancellor of the state university, Port Harcourt. The development was contained in a statement issued on Wednesday, July 17, on behalf of the governor by Nwakaudu.

The statement noted that Governor Wike made the appointment in exercise of the powers conferred on him by section 3 and schedule 1 of the Rivers state university law, 2017.
